How Blockchain Could Possibly End Travel Industry Problems !
At this point, most blockchain enthusiasts know that distributed ledger tech has potential beyond fintech. Yet, one industry that hasn't seen much attention from those enthusiasts is the travel industry. And it's one that deals regularly with a number of pain points that blockchain technology has the potential to solve.
Here are some of the more notable issues and how blockchain could help:
1. Overbooking
2. Fraud
3. Identity and reputation
4. Traveller profiles
5. Settlement
6. Loyalty
7. Policy and compliance
8. Duty of care
9. Smart contracts
10. Removing silos
However, both public and private blockchains have advantages in the travel industry.
The established public blockchains, such as bitcoin and ethereum, have an advantage in scale both of payments and the applications that can be built on them, compared to the newer alternatives. Newer and smaller blockchains, on the other hand, will have an easier task achieving the network-wide consensus required to make strategic changes to the protocol.
